Lauren Hutton Biography
Lauren Hutton is a famous American model and actress who was born and brought up in the southern United States. She moved to New York City in her early adulthood to begin a modeling career.
Though she was previously dismissed by agents for a signature gap in her teeth, Hutton signed a modeling contract with Revlon in 1973, which at the time was the biggest contract in the history of the modeling industry.
Hutton has been working both as a model and an actress throughout her career, making her film debut in the sports drama Paper Lion in 1968, opposite Alan Alda. She as well played central roles in The Gambler (1974) and American Gigolo (1980), and later appeared on television in the network series Paper Dolls and Nip/Tuck.
Hutton has also been modeling into her seventies, appearing in numerous advertising campaigns for H&M, Taylor, and Lord, and Alexander Wang, and performed on the runway for Tom Ford’s spring 2012 collection, and also for Bottega Veneta at the 2016 New York Fashion Week.

Lauren Hutton Education
Hutton graduated from Chamberlain High School in Tampa in 1961. Later on, she was among the first students to attend the University of South Florida in 1961 and also attended Newcomb College, then a coordinate college within Tulane University and graduated with a Bachelor of Arts degree in 1964.
Lauren Hutton Family
Hutton was born and raised by her father, Lawrence Hutton, and her mother, Minnie Hutton in the southern United States. Her father was a native of Mississippi, where he grew up next door to William Faulkner and was stationed in England during World War II.
After the war, Lauren Hutton’s mother divorced her father, and she relocated to Miami, and later, Tampa, Florida, where Hutton spent the remainder of her early life. Hutton took the surname “Hall”, after her mother remarried, although her stepfather never formally adopted her.

Lauren Hutton Vogue
Her contract with Revlon garnered Hutton’s further modeling work, and she became a “cover girl,” appearing on the front cover of Vogue a record 26 times. She was the oldest woman to ever appear in a vogue At 74.
She appeared on the Vogue Italia cover. In her official statement, she said, she had been thinking about it for a while, but it took Vogue Italia’s courage to make it true. The cover can change society because it shows a woman who is vibrant, attractive, who still laughs, and who for the first time is a woman her age.

Lauren Hutton Once Bitten
Huttons was Countess in the film titled Once Bitten. Once Bitten was a 1985 American teen horror sex comedy film, starring Lauren Hutton, Karen Kopins, and Jim Carrey. Carrey had his first major lead role playing Mark Kendall, an innocent and naïve high school student who was seduced in a Hollywood nightclub by a sultry blonde countess (Hutton), who unknown to him is a centuries-old vampire.

Lauren Hutton Teeth Gap
Previously, Hutton was set aside by agents for a signature gap in her teeth, Hutton signed a modeling contract with Revlon in 1973, which at the time was the biggest contract in the history of the modeling industry.
One of Hutton’s most remarkable features was noticeably absent from a few of her early Vogue covers and the supermodel got creative to cover it up. Prior to fronting the fashion magazine’s September 1970 and January 1975 issues, Hutton stuck mortician’s wax in between her two front teeth to alter her smile.
“I had already invented a little piece of very soft wax. It was called mortician’s wax, and I could make a little bead out of that and stick it between my two front teeth and then take a butter knife and make a line,”
Hutton, now 77, told Vogue in a recent interview published on Tuesday. Although she “certainly agreed with the boss that yes, I would do whatever necessary,” the supermodel admitted, “I kinda thought that I would make it somehow.”
